General Hospital’s Laura Wright Says Carly ‘Will Do Whatever It Takes’ To Protect Michael (EXCL)

On General Hospital, notorious mama bear Carly Spencer has reason to fear that the firstborn of her cubs, Michael Corinthos (Rory Gibson), may go down for shooting her ex-lover, Congressman Drew Cain (Cameron Mathison). And if history is any indication, there’s nothing she won’t do to make sure he stays out of jail. Soap Opera Digest checked in with Laura Wright (Carly) about the unfolding drama.

By Any Means Necessary

According to the actress, Carly is worried about more than Michael getting accused of the shooting — she actually thinks he might be guilty. “She knows from how he’s acting that he’s not 100 percent telling the truth,” Wright points out. “She thinks there’s a chance that he could have done it, 100 percent. Does she think he 100 percent did it? No! But there is a chance, and she’s said that a couple of times: ‘There’s a chance Michael did it, there’s a chance!’ ”

Michael had a good deal of motive to pull the trigger — but so, too, did Carly, so she’s not necessarily judging. However, “Of course she would care [if he was actually responsible for the shooting],” Wright says. “She would care because she doesn’t want her son to hurt somebody. You don’t want to see your child kill somebody or try to, or to be so angry that he’s going to hurt someone in a way that could put him in prison forever. She doesn’t want him to go to jail. And she’ll do everything she can to stop that from happening.”

And as Elizabeth observed in the October 8 episode, that “everything” includes increasing the odds that the PCPD suspect her of the crime. “Carly will do whatever she has to do to protect her kids,” Wright declares. “Whatever it takes. Even take the blame herself.”
Michael, meanwhile, has been quite busy himself trying to deflect the PCPC’s attention, particularly by trying to shore up an alibi for the night of the shooting that pivots around Jacinda. And, grown man that he is, it’s not necessarily his first choice to have Carly take it upon herself to keep him out of the cops’ crosshairs. But Carly being Carly, the chances that she’ll drop her quest are pretty slim, even if he asks her to back off. “Never!” scoffs Wright. “Never, never, never.”
While the whodunit is giving both Carly and Michael some sleepless nights, the actress says that she’s having a blast continuing the mother/son dynamic between Carly/Michael opposite Rory Gibson, who assumed the role of Michael from Chad Duell earlier this year. “I love Rory!” she smiles. “He is so great — always prepared, comes to set, knows his lines, ready to play. We have a great time together! I love working with him. It’s a lot of fun.”
